5 shot en route to wedding ceremony in Noakhali

Miscreants shot five people while traveling to a wedding’s gaye holud ceremony in Begumganj, Noakhali around 11:15 pm on Monday.
Begumganj Police Station Officer-in-Charge (OC) Md Shamsuzzaman confirmed the matter. Among the victims, one is in critical condition and has been sent to Dhaka for advanced medical treatment.
The victims have been identified as Nazrul Islam Shanto, Maruf Ahmed, Jasim Uddin, Sakib Hossain, and Bablu. Locals rescued the injured and admitted them to the 250-bed Noakhali General Hospital.
Shanto said, “We were going to record video at a gaye holud ceremony using three motorcycles and two auto-rickshaws, accompanied by several women. At that time, miscreants shot at our motorcycles from behind.”
He added that they sustained gunshot wounds and claimed he recognized locals Harun and Picchi Riyad among the attackers.
In his allegation, Shanto noted, “Riyad commented that I am involved with Jamaat-Shibir and threatened to shoot me by pressing a pistol to my leg.”
Locals said the shooting was the result of a pre-existing dispute between locals Harun and Rayhan. Multiple sources added that Harun and his associates allegedly opened fire on the group, mistaking them for their rival Rayhan’s people. Multiple attempts to reach the accused, Harun and Riyad, were unsuccessful.
OC Shamsuzzaman said police have visited the scene and will take legal action.
